Acerca de esta escucha

Every year for two decades, David Payne invites his five closest college friends to travel with him on a weeklong humanitarian mission. And each year, they are too busy. This year, however, when David's funeral reunites them, they decide to fulfill his mission to a far-flung Pacific island. But something unplanned and mind-boggling occurs.

Christy Award-winning author Angela Hunt delivers an unforgettable, critically acclaimed tale that explores how materialism, beauty, and prestige often mask reality.

Reseñas de la Crítica

"Hunt excels at reminding Christian readers that God judges petty sins the same as heinous ones, and that being a 'good person' outwardly often hides an interior life that is far from pure." (Publishers Weekly)
"An accelerating sense of menace." (Booklist)
